EXAMPLE WELD INSPECTION REPORT/SENTENCE SHEET

PRINT FULL NAME I C Plenty


SPECIMEN NUMBER 001
EXTERNAL DEFECTS Defects Noted Code or Specification Reference

Defect Type Pipe/Plate Accumulative Maximum Section/ Accept/Reject


Section Total Allowance Table No 5
1 2 3 4

Excess weld metal height A-C 4mm 2mm 15 Reject


Excess weld metal appearance A-C Poor blend Smooth 8 Reject
Incomplete filling A-C 22mm None 5 Reject

Inadequate weld width (PIPE) A-C N/A ------------ ---------- Accept

Slag Inclusions A-C 70mm long 50mm 9 Reject

Undercut A-C 1.5mm depth 1mm 6 Reject

Surface Porosity A-C 1.5mm  1mm 2 Reject

Cracks/Crack-like defects A-C 40mm NONE 1 Reject*

Lack of fusion A-C 22mm NONE 3 Reject

Arc strikes A-C 3 NONE 7 Reject***


Mechanical damage A-C NONE ------------ ----------- Accept

Laps/Laminations A-C NONE ------------ ----------- Accept

Misalignment (Linear) A-C 2mm 2mm 15 Accept

Longitudinal seams (PIPE) A-C N/A ------------ ---------- Accept

Root Defects

Misalignment A-C 2mm 2mm 9 Accept

Excessive Root Penetration A-C 4mm 2mm 15 Reject

Incomplete Root Penetration A-C 50mm NONE 13 Reject

Lack of Root Fusion A-C 20mm NONE 11 Reject

Root Concavity A-C 2mm depth 1mm 10 Reject

Root Undercut A-C NONE ------------ ---------- Accept

Cracks/Crack-like defects A-C NONE ------------ ---------- Accept

Slag inclusions A-C NONE ------------ 9 Accept

Porosity A-C NONE ------------ 2 Accept

Laps/Laminations A-C NONE ------------ ---------- Accept

This *pipe/plate has been examined to the requirements of code/specification TWI-N/WIS-PI


.........................................
and is accepted/rejected accordingly.

Comments:
* Request MPI testing to confirm crack and length.
** Large amount of spatter on weld face. Recommend this is removed and re inspected.
*** Recommend arc strikes are ground flush prior to MPI testing for cracks.

Inspection Practice Specification
Number TWI 09-09-03
All dimensions are given in mm
No Imperfection Comments Allowance
1 Cracks All types of cracks Not permitted

2 Porosity/Gas pores/elongated Cluster Max dimension of area L = 13mm Max


Gas cavities (wormholes) pipes Single pore Max dimension L = 1mm Max
3 Solid Inclusions Non metallic. Individual size Maximum 1mm
4 Solid Inclusions Metallic. Individual size Not permitted
5 Lack of Fusion Side wall/Root/Inter-run Not permitted
6 Incomplete Root Penetration Not permitted
7 Overlap/Cold lap Weld face/Root Not permitted
8 Incompletely filled groove Not permitted
9 Linear Misalignment 0.2t Maximum 4mm
10 Angular Misalignment Maximum 10º
11 Undercut Smoothly blended 10%t Maximum d 1mm
12 Arc Strikes Area to be tested by MPI Seek advice
13 Laminations Not permitted
14 Mechanical Damage Not permitted
15 Cap Height Shall fall below plate surface 0 –3mm h Maximum
16 Penetration Bead 0 –2mm h Maximum
17 Toe Blend Smooth
18 Spatter Clean & Re-inspect Refer to manufacturer
19 Weld Appearance All runs shall blend smoothly Regular
20 Root concavity 10%t Maximum
